Я пытаюсь установить сцепку для прекращения действия сертификатов на обратный прокси-сервер лака на моем Ubuntu 16,04 VPS. Установка завершается следующими сообщениями, и служба Hitch не запускается.
sridhar@SastraTechnologies:~$ sudo apt install hitch
Reading package lists... Done
Building dependency tree
Reading state information... Done
The following package was automatically installed and is no longer required:
libuv1
Use 'sudo apt autoremove' to remove it.
The following NEW packages will be installed:
hitch
0 upgraded, 1 newly installed, 0 to remove and 100 not upgraded.
Need to get 0 B/51.1 kB of archives.
After this operation, 163 kB of additional disk space will be used.
Selecting previously unselected package hitch.
(Reading database ... 249839 files and directories currently installed.)
Preparing to unpack .../hitch_1.1.1-1_amd64.deb ...
Unpacking hitch (1.1.1-1) ...
Processing triggers for systemd (229-4ubuntu21.27) ...
Processing triggers for ureadahead (0.100.0-19.1) ...
Processing triggers for man-db (2.7.5-1) ...
Setting up hitch (1.1.1-1) ...
insserv: Script nagios is broken: incomplete LSB comment.
insserv: missing `Default-Start:' entry: please add even if empty.
insserv: missing `Default-Stop:' entry: please add even if empty.
insserv: Default-Start undefined, assuming empty start runlevel(s) for script `nagios'
insserv: Default-Stop undefined, assuming empty stop runlevel(s) for script `nagios'
Попыталась удалить пакет, обновив репозиторий и установив его снова, но результаты те же. Есть ли что-нибудь, что я могу сделать для разрешения сообщений insserv?
-121--306016-У меня есть собственный DNS-сервер в моей сети, который я хочу, чтобы все клиенты использовали (он имеет ad-фильтры и т.д., как PiHole).
Я настроил маршрутизатор (LinkSys Velop) на использование этого DNS-сервера. Однако на странице администрирования DNS-сервера я вижу только Маршрутизатор, выполняющий DNS-запросы, а не клиенты. Я бы предположил, что маршрутизатор (рано или поздно) велит клиентам использовать определенный DNS-сервер. Несмотря на перезапуск клиентов (и выполнение различных других действий по сбросу сети, таких как ipconfig/flushdns
и т.д., они, похоже, не имеют прямого доступа к DNS-серверу: это делает только маршрутизатор.
Пока единственным способом получить доступ клиентов непосредственно к DNS-серверу был ввод DNS-сервера вручную в конфигурации клиентской сети.
Итак, вопросы:
спасибо!
Маршрутизатор, как и просто устройство + программное обеспечение, которое выполняет пересылку IP-пакетов, вообще ничего не делает с DNS или DHCP ...
Хотя, поскольку вы упомянули устройство, которое обычно используется как широкополосное соединение для SOHO / дома роутер. Это устройство, которое обеспечивает маршрутизацию, NAT, брандмауэр, DNS, DHCP и многие другие службы.
В любом случае, когда клиент, настроенный для IPv4 DHCP и не имеющий статической конфигурации, подключается к сети, он отправляет запрос DHCP, который будет включать запрос данных параметра 6, который представляет собой список IP-адресов для использоваться для DNS. Сервер DHCP может предоставить ответ со списком IP-адресов. Как только клиент получит ответ, он будет продолжать использовать эти DNS-серверы до тех пор, пока адрес не будет выпущен или не обновлен и не будет предоставлена обновленная информация.
Итак, если вы хотите заставить клиента получать обновленные настройки DNS с DHCP-сервера, вам необходимо выполнить обновление на клиенте. Хотя перезагрузка, отключение и повторное подключение сетевого интерфейса обычно также вызывают это.
SOHO / домашние маршрутизаторы обычно не могут быть настроены со стандартной прошивкой. Часто можно получить больше контроля, используя нестандартную прошивку. Или просто запускаете службы на другом устройстве в вашей сети.
DHCP-сервер (вероятно, работающий на вашем маршрутизаторе) предлагает клиентам IP-адреса DNS-серверов, которые они могут использовать.
Вам нужно настроить их.
Если вы не можете этого сделать, что вполне возможно с маршрутизаторами SOHO, скорее всего, сам маршрутизатор будет либо предлагать клиентам IP-адреса DNS-серверов, которые сам маршрутизатор использует для DNS, либо маршрутизатор всегда будет предлагать свой собственный IP-адрес в качестве DNS-сервера. Тогда на маршрутизаторе вы можете часто (неявно) настроить прямой и обратный DNS для вашей частной сети, а для всех остальных запросов маршрутизатор будет перенаправлять запросы на свои собственные внешние DNS-серверы.
В последнем примере вы увидите, что все клиентские запросы также исходят от IP-адреса маршрутизатора